Kristin Cope is a skilled trial and appellate lawyer. Her practice focuses on complex litigation, frequently involving high-stakes business disputes and cutting-edge issues in the intellectual property, energy, technology, and financial sectors. She has represented clients in state and federal trial courts, various Federal Circuit Courts of Appeals and the United States Supreme Court. She is skilled at combining bold stand-up representation with goal-oriented approaches to litigation to protect and advance her clients' interests.
Ms. Cope has substantial experience in disputes regarding trade secrets and other intellectual property, breach of contract, breach of fiduciary duty, business torts, consumer liability, and class action claims. She has briefed and argued complex appellate issues in multiple industries and courts, as well as advised on appellate preservation and strategy issues during trial.
Following graduation from law school, Ms. Cope served as law clerk to the Honorable David W. McKeague of the United States Court of Appeals for the Sixth Circuit.
